Wrangell's JOM dancers, in partnership with SEARHC, made use of the high school's workshop to carve some paddles which are going to be part of the Wrangell dancers' performance during Celebration 2020, according to Delila Ramirez. Celebration occurs every other year in Juneau, where native communities across Alaska come together to share their culture in songs, dances, art, and food. Wrangell will be the lead dance group for Celebration this summer. Pictured here is Ramirez working on her paddle.
